At Neath Station, ticket buying and collection are made simple with a ticket office open every day of the week. Opening hours are extensive, with weekday operations from 05:30 to 18:30 and slightly adjusted hours over the weekend. For convenience, there are ticket machines available, including accessible machines fitted with induction loops to assist passengers with hearing difficulties. Additionally, Neath Station upholds safety and comfort with CCTV coverage and step-free access throughout the station, categorising it with the highest level of accessibility (Category A).
Facilities extend beyond ticketing. You can unwind in the station's waiting room, open daily from 06:00 to 21:30. If you need a refreshment, the Hi Coffee Express Cafe provides a delightful range of hot and cold beverages and pastries to perk up your journey. The accessible toilets, including baby change facilities, further ensure that passengers of all needs are catered for. Although there are no shops or ATMs within the station, these basic comforts make Neath an accommodating station for all.
Neath Station is committed to providing support to all passengers. If you require any help, staff assistance is available from 06:00 to 22:00 every day. The station is equipped for step-free access to both platforms and utilizes both a footbridge with steps and lifts for crossing between platforms. In addition, there’s an opportunity to book Passenger Assistance up to two hours in advance if you need aid for your trip, which ensures peace of mind for over a thousand journeys each day. It's worth noting, though, that while accessible taxis are not available directly from the station, you'll find plenty of accessible pick-up and set-down points.

Blackrod Train Station, nestled in the borough of Bolton, Greater Manchester, is an unstaffed yet accessible railway station perfect for day-trippers and regular commuters alike. Whether you're a local resident or a visitor exploring the North West, understanding what Blackrod Station offers can ensure a smooth journey. Let's dive into everything you need to know about this station, from facilities and connections to popular destinations.
Blackrod Train Station operates without a ticket office, so be sure to purchase your tickets online or use one of the accessible ticket machines available on site. While smartcards can be issued and validated here, do note that there's no provision for collecting tickets bought online. The station lacks certain amenities, including luggage storage, restrooms, and refreshment facilities, emphasizing a need for pre-planning before arriving.
For accessibility, Blackrod provides step-free access to platforms via ramps, although they are lengthy and require allowing additional time to navigate. CCTV is absent, so keeping an eye on personal belongings is advisable. Assistance can be sought from conductors or via designated help points, crucial for travelers requiring extra support.
Beyond the trains, Blackrod has various links to other modes of transportation, ensuring you can reach your ultimate destination with ease. Local buses are accessible from stops on Station Road, and although there isn't an inbuilt taxi stand, services like Cab4You can be utilized for onward travel. Cyclists will find bicycle storage available, albeit with limited spaces, and while bicycle hire isn't offered on-site, options are generally accessible nearby.
